Decoration
Webster's Dictionary
(1):
(n.) The act of adorning, embellishing, or honoring; ornamentation.
(2):
(n.) That which adorns, enriches, or beautifies; something added by way of embellishment; ornament.
(3):
(n.) Specifically, any mark of honor to be worn upon the person, as a medal, cross, or ribbon of an order of knighthood, bestowed for services in war, great achievements in literature, art, etc.
